1. RTP (Return to Player): 96.4%

The RTP of 96.4% indicates that, on average, a player can expect to receive back approximately 96.4 coins for every 100 wagered. This leaves a house edge of 3.6%, which is quite standard in the industry. This RTP suggests that the game is relatively favorable for players, though as with all slot games, actual returns can vary significantly from this average in the short term.

Simple Expected Return Calculation:

Assuming a player spins 1,000 times with a $1.00 bet (total wager: $1,000), we calculate the expected return:

Expected Return = Total Wager × RTP = 1,000 × 0.964 = $964

Expected loss = $36

This calculation shows that, while players may have the potential for big wins, they must also be prepared for losses as they navigate through different spins.
